Event or Professional Use
In professional or recreational climbing contexts, this automatic lock carabiner can function as part of a personal anchor system, for clipping into bolts, or for organising gear on a harness. Its multiple colour options (Black, Blue, Orange, Red, Silver) are useful for colour-coding different types of gear or for quick visual identification during complex setups.

Reuse and Low Maintenance
As a piece of metallic climbing hardware, it is inherently designed for repeated use. Proper maintenance for any climbing carabiner involves regular inspection for cracks, gate function, and wear, and cleaning according to material-specific guidelines.
